Background technology
Circle component of rod category is common section bar or parts in industrial production, including solid round rod and Hollow circular beam, according to The division of length has long round bar and end round bar, and round bar class section bar needs to be processed further by numerically controlled lathe, including vehicle outside Circle and turning end etc. are to improve the surface quality of round bar class section bar, to facilitate deep processing or assembling below;Automatic metaplasia Production has become industrial main trend, and automatic loading/unloading is production technology common in automated production, circle component of rod category Automation loading and unloading be using manipulator cooperation numerically-controlled machine tool processed automatically, how will justify component of rod category pass through manipulator It is automatic loading/unloading emphasis to be installed in the chuck of numerically controlled lathe and take out it out of chuck.
Circle component of rod category needs to carry out turnery processing to its both ends during machine tooling, then needs manipulator fixture It carries out gripping commutation to be again mounted in chuck, intermediate overturn can be gripped by fixture for longer circle component of rod category .However for the shorter circle component of rod category of length, the outer length of stretching chuck is shorter, and the actuator of manipulator occupies one Space surely, grips the outer wall of short round bar without enough spaces for fixture vertical direction at this time in lathe, the prior art is adopted Method is to be placed, overturn using intermediate tray, then changes head by what fixture carried out that gripping realizes short round bar part;This Kind swap method greatly increases the movement travel of manipulator, seriously affects the work efficiency of automation.

Embodiment
A kind of short component of rod category automatic loading/unloading manipulator fixture of the present embodiment, with reference to Fig. 1-3:, including ring flange 1, the bottom of ring flange 1 has been fixed by the bracket installing plate 2, and the bottom of installing plate 2 is equipped with rotary cylinder 3, rotary cylinder 3 Bottom is fixed with square plate 4, and the bottom of square plate 4 is fixed with pneumatic-finger 5, peace is fixed respectively on the outer wall of the finger of pneumatic-finger 5 Equipped with L-type connecting rod 6, rectangular slab 7 is fixed on the external opposite ends face of L-type connecting rod 6, laterally homogeneous fixation on the outer wall of rectangular slab 7 There is arc panel 8, first clamping plate 9 and second clamping plate 10, first clamping plate 9 and second clamping plate are respectively fixed on the inner wall of arc panel 8 10 be curved splint, and the inner wall of first clamping plate 9 is symmetrically fixed with support base 11, rolling is rotatably connected on support base 11 above and below Wheel 12, second clamping plate 10 is fixedly arranged in the middle of rectangular block 13, opens up fluted on the left side of rectangular block 13, and chain is equipped in groove Drive mechanism 14 is uniformly fixed with supporting rod 17, the sprocket wheel external stability of chain drive structure 14 on the chain of chain drive structure 14 There is motor 15, support plate 16 is fixed in the bottom interior wall of groove, the inside of chain is in contact with the left side of support plate 16.
Motor 15 is stepper motor 15, the model 42J1834-810 of stepper motor 15, and using matched 15 driver of M415B subdivision types stepper motor.
The rear end of rectangular slab 7 is fixed with elastic telescopicing rod, and the end of elastic telescopicing rod is equipped with close to switch;Close to switch Model LC1.5-1B, close to switch setting preventing short component of rod category 18 in first clamping plate 9 and second clamping plate 10 The length stretched out after movement exceeds designated length.
Rubber mount is all fixed in the top of supporting rod 17 and the circular arc outer wall of runner;Rubber mount can be prevented effectively Idler wheel 12 and supporting rod 17 damage the processing quality of machined surface when clamping short component of rod category 18.
Geometric center of the line of symmetry of support base 11 Jing Guo first clamping plate 9;Such design can be realized in first clamping plate 9 When clamping short component of rod category 18 with second clamping plate 10, the top of idler wheel 12 is in contact with the outer wall of short component of rod category 18, thus with More steadily supported at three point is formed between supporting rod 17;Ensure short component of rod category 18 in first clamping plate 9 and second clamping plate 10 The stability of clamping.
Rotary cylinder 3 is 180 ° of rotary cylinders 3.
The u-turn principle of short component of rod category 18:, it is necessary to another after the completion of one end turnery processing of short component of rod category 18 When end carries out u-turn processing, manipulator is moved to designated position according to desired guiding trajectory first, even if first clamping plate 9 and second clamping plate 10 are located at the front of machine chuck axis, then by opening pneumatic-finger 5, first clamping plate 9 and second clamping plate 10 are unfolded, leads to The horizontal Forward of manipulator is crossed, first clamping plate 9 and second clamping plate 10 is made to be located at the outside of short component of rod category 18, then by shrinking gas It starts finger 5, first clamping plate 9 and second clamping plate 10 is made to clamp short component of rod category 18, at this time chuck is coordinated to open, by short component of rod category 18 take out;The undressed end of short component of rod category 18 is stretched out with outside first clamping plate 9 and second clamping plate 10, passing through stepper motor at this time 15 startup drives chain drive structure 14 to work, and short component of rod category 18 is made to move and wear in first clamping plate 9 and second clamping plate 10 Go out, the machined end of the short component of rod category 18 after being pierced by is located at outside, finally by rotary cylinder 3 by first clamping plate 9 and second Clamping plate 10 rotates 180 °, and the machined one end of short component of rod category 18 is put into chuck and completes u-turn installation.
